Strong’s H160 · Hebrew

אַהֲבָה
ʼahăbâh
a-hab-aw

Definition

{affection (in a good or a bad sense)}

Etymology

feminine of H158 (אַהַב) and meaning the same

Where the KJV renders it

  • love
